    This film was a collaboration with students and faculty at the University of British Columbia, and filmed in Greece, in and around Galaxidi. The text is a chorus from Sophocles' Antigone, lines 332-375. The chorus is sometimes known as the 'Ode to Man' or 'Deinos Chorus' or 'Polla ta deina'. Many of the students featured are studying in the UBC Department of Theatre and Film.
    The film is produced by Mairin O'Hagan and Hallie Marshall, directed by Helen Eastman, composed by Alex Silverman, whth cinematography by Michael Garrett. For a full list of contributors, and funders (thank you), see the film's closing credits.
